Grep for "typecasts on min/max could be min_t/max_t" in > scripts/checkpatch.pl. IMHO that is a really bad suggestion (and always has been). In reality min(a, (T)b) is less likely to be buggy than min_t(T, a, b). Someone will notice that (u16)long_var is likely to be buggy but min_t() is expected to 'do something magic'. There are a log of examples of 'T_var = min_t(T, T_var, b)' which really needed (typeof (b))T_var rather than (T)b and T_var = min_t(T, a, b) which just doesn't need a cast at all. > > And historically you could not pass different types to min() and max(), > which is why people use min_t() and max_t().
